Understanding ThermiVa
ThermiVa is a cutting-edge treatment designed to improve the appearance and function of the vaginal area. It uses controlled radiofrequency energy to gently heat the tissues, stimulating collagen production and enhancing blood flow. This process helps to tighten the vaginal canal, improve lubrication, and enhance overall vaginal health. ThermiVa is particularly beneficial for women experiencing symptoms related to aging, childbirth, or menopause.
Optimal Age Range for ThermiVa
While there is no strict age limit for ThermiVa, the treatment is most commonly sought by women in their 40s and 50s. This age group often experiences significant changes in vaginal health due to menopause, which can lead to issues like dryness, laxity, and incontinence. However, younger women who have undergone childbirth or are experiencing early menopause symptoms may also benefit from ThermiVa. It's essential to consult with a healthcare provider to determine if ThermiVa is appropriate for your specific age and health condition.

FAQ
Q: Is ThermiVa painful?
A: No, ThermiVa is a painless procedure. The radiofrequency energy is applied gently, and most women report feeling only a mild warming sensation during the treatment.
Q: How many ThermiVa sessions are needed?
A: Typically, three sessions spaced one month apart are recommended for optimal results. However, this may vary based on individual needs and goals.
Q: Are there any side effects of ThermiVa?
A: ThermiVa is generally well-tolerated with minimal side effects. Some women may experience mild swelling or redness in the treated area, but these effects are usually temporary and resolve quickly.
